How Water Heater Leak Water Removal Actually Works
Our team’s process for Water Heater Leak Water Removal is designed to be efficient, effective, and stress-free for homeowners. We understand that every minute counts with water damage, and that’s why we respond quickly and get to work fast. Our process includes:
Step 1: Assessment and Extraction
Our technicians will arrive at your home and assess the damage, identifying the source of the leak and the extent of the water dam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water, including wet/dry vacuums and submersible pumps. Our goal is to remove as much water as possible in the first hour to prevent further damage.
Step 2: Drying and Dehumidifying
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the affected area. This includes using industrial-grade fans and dehumidifiers to remove moisture and prevent mold growth. We’ll work to dry the area within 3-5 days to prevent further damage and ensure a thorough cleanup.
Step 3: Cleaning and Disinfecting
After the drying process is complete, we’ll clean and disinfect the affected area to remove any remaining moisture and prevent mold growth. This includes using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ure a thorough cleaning. We’ll take the time to ensure every surface is clean and disinfected to prevent further damage and ensure your home is safe to occupy.
Step 4: Restoration and Repair
Finally, we’ll work with you to restore your home to its original condition, including repairing any damaged materials and replacing any necessary items. We’ll work with you to develop a customized plan to ensure your home is restored to its original condition.

Water Heater Leak Water Removal Cost in Pilot Mountain, NC
The cost of Water Heater Leak Water Removal in Pilot Mountain, NC can vary based on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Prices start at $500 and can go up to $2,500 or more depending on the extent of the damage. What affects the cost includes: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Extraction | $500 – $1,000 | Severity of leak, size of affected area |
| Drying and Dehumidifying | $1,000 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of drying process |
| Cleaning and Disinfecting | $500 – $1,000 | Severity of mold or mildew growth, complexity of cleaning process |
| Restoration and Repair | $1,000 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, complexity of repair process |
| Equipment and Labor | $500 – $1,000 | Complexity of job, number of technicians required |
| Permits and Inspections | $100 – $500 | Local regulations and requirements |
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ates to ensure you know what to expect.
